Found this on an Orioles forum... I think it'spretty well said.
[quote]There's some truth here, but I think it simplifies an important distinction. I think it's not that Ray Lewis "clearly" gets a pass because he's a hometown guy, but that hometown fans are more likely to withhold judgement until everything comes to light and they've done their research. Opposing fans that dislike the Ravens, want, consciously or subconsciously, for that dislike to be rational and are happy with the narrative that Lewis is a murderer. It gives your team some vague sense of moral superiority.

All fans are guilty of this, just not as many have things to latch onto with the same gravity as the Lewis scandal. Roethlisberger is a good example. I don't like the Steelers. I don't like Roethlisberger. And my opinion of him as a scumbag is definitely influenced by the sketchy charges against him. But the reality is I don't actually know much about the incident or the accusations or the legal proceedings. (For this reason, I also don't go around openly accusing Ben of being a [profanity deleted].) Steelers fans are probably much more knowledgeable on this subject.

If accusations came out claiming ARod was a child molester, Baltimore fans (all other fans, really) would be much faster to assign guilt than Yankees fans. That's not to say Yankees fans would give him a free pass, just that they are going to wait until all the evidence is available before castigating the guy.

[b]Lying to the police is no joke, especially when two people were stabbed in the heart, and Ray's behavior in the incident was not admirable. But he was young and dumb and, most importantly, he did not murder anyone.[/b] The testimony of the only witness who even claimed Lewis was directly involved in the altercation is dubious. Lewis was rightly charged with Obstruction of Justice and paid his dues. Then, as others have pointed out, he did a great deal to turn his life around and help those around him. To point this out is not giving Lewis "a pass" simply because he's a great football player for the hometown team, it's protecting the reputation of man whose integrity is frequently and ignorantly dragged through the mud. To accuse Lewis of keeping unsavory company and wrongly trying to protect said company is totally fair, to accuse him of murder is not.

I feel I can be fairly objective about this because I didn't start following the Ravens until ~2006, well after the super bowl or the murders.

.....I don't see how anyone can not see this as a major point. Baltimore fans are passionate about Ray because we've seen what he means to people on and off the field. We know who he has become. He plead guilty to the misdemeanor, did his probation and changed his life. For people to hold that night against him after everything that has transpired since reeks of jealousy and sour grapes.
